电脑ARP什么时候发

小编 2024-07-28 21

在日常生活与工作中,网络对于咱们来说已经是必不可少的啦!而说到网络,有一个词儿你一定不陌生,那就是ARP,你有没有想过,电脑ARP究竟在什么时候发起呢?就让我来为你揭秘一下吧!

电脑ARP什么时候发

我们要知道ARP是什么,ARP全称是Address Resolution Protocol,中文翻译为地址解析协议,它的作用是将网络层地址(如IP地址)转换成链路层地址(如MAC地址),以便在局域网中进行数据传输。

在我们的电脑中,ARP的具体发起时机主要有以下几种情况:

1、当我们尝试访问局域网内其他主机时,本机会首先检查自己的ARP缓存中是否有目标IP地址对应的MAC地址,如果没有,就会发起ARP请求。

在这样一个场景下,想象一下,你的电脑小A想要给同一局域网的小B发送一份文件,小A知道小B的IP地址,但不知道小B的MAC地址,这时,小A就会发起ARP请求,询问:“谁是xxx.xxx.xxx.xxx这个IP地址的主人呀?请告诉我你的MAC地址。”收到回复后,小A就可以将文件发送给小B了。

2、当我们访问局域网外的主机时,如果目标主机不在同一局域网内,那么本机会向默认网关发送ARP请求,获取网关的MAC地址。

这里举个例子,如果你的电脑小C想访问互联网上的一个网站,它首先会向默认网关发送ARP请求,因为网关是连接局域网和外部网络的桥梁,小C会询问:“网关大人,请问你的MAC地址是多少呀?我想出去逛逛。”得到网关的MAC地址后,小C就可以把数据包发送给网关,进而访问互联网。

3、在某些网络故障排除的情况下,我们也会手动发起ARP请求,当你发现无法访问局域网内的某台主机时,可以使用“arp -a”命令查看ARP缓存,或者使用“arp -d”命令清除缓存,然后重新发起ARP请求。

以下是关键时刻:以下是电脑ARP发起的具体时间点:

- 每次启动电脑时,本机会自动发起ARP请求,获取局域网内其他主机的MAC地址,以便后续通信。

- 当我们打开一个新的网络连接时,如果需要与局域网内外的主机通信,会发起ARP请求。

- 当ARP缓存中的条目过期时,本机会重新发起ARP请求,以获取最新的MAC地址。

了解了这些,你是不是对电脑ARP的发起时机有了更清晰的认识呢?网络世界中的奥秘还有很多,让我们一起探索吧!

悄悄告诉你一个小技巧:在日常使用电脑时,注意保护好自己的网络环境,避免ARP欺骗等网络安全问题,这样,我们才能更好地享受网络带来的便利哦!

The End
微信